Time has laid its attire aside: fashion in manuscripts from the 11th-16th centuries

Abstract

The publication draws attention to the world of fashion and the dressing of the medieval and early modern society of the Czech lands through medieval illuminations and reports of the temporary commentators. The author studies the development of clothing in the range from the eleventh century to the beginning of the seventeenth century according to social groups, from the most powerful and the richest to the marginalized.

It is based on preserved medieval and early modern illuminations, different types of clothing of different social groups are introduced. Male and female clothes are described separately.

It describes the main parts of clothing, devotes to accessories, symbolism of colors and affects, as well as various fashion trends and frills.
